“The Mandalorian” star Pedro Pascal, “Guardians of the Galaxy” actress Karen Gillan and “Borat” sequel breakout Maria Bakalova are set to join Judd Apatow’s latest meta-comedy feature “The Bubble”.
That’s not all though as Iris Apatow, Fred Armisen, David Duchovny, Keegan-Michael Key, Leslie Mann and Peter Serafinowicz will also star in the film which will shoot from next week.
The story follows a group of actors and actresses stuck inside a pandemic bubble at a hotel attempting to complete a studio franchise film. It is said to be in part inspired by the living and working conditions impacting large scale productions last year such as “Jurassic Park: Dominion”.
Gillan and Pascal will play the made-up franchise’s stars while Mann and Duchovny will play a once-married acting duo now forced to quarantine under one roof.
Apatow is directing from a script he co-wrote with Pam Brady. He will also produce while Barry Mendel will executive produce.
